"Walk of the Roses" and 2023 Commencement

On Tuesday, the Class of 2023 took part in one of the Academy’s most beloved traditions, the “Walk of the Roses.”
The class processed down the steps of the Academy building towards Rocky River Drive. The Saint Joseph Academy and West Park communities lined the street, clapping and celebrating the class as they walked to Our Lady of Angels Church.
 
Commencement opened with the singing of the alma mater and a Welcome Address from Principal Mr. Jeff Sutliff followed by a scripture reading from Valedictorian and National Merit Finalist Alicia Blouch ’23. Board of Directors' Member Ms. Margaret Sweeney ’03 provided this year's Commencement speech.
 
Class Moderators Ms. Ali Conkey and Ms. Maggie Flannery who have helped guide the Class of 2023 over their past four years read the names of the graduates as they received their diplomas from President Mrs. Kathryn Purcell and shook hands with Principal Mr. Jeff Sutliff.
 
Student Speaker Ella "El" Healey shared, "We are on the verge of an incredible transition full of opportunities. It may be intimidating but do not ignore it. Try the things you have wondered about, keep learning, remember to laugh, and never stop loving each other. Sister Juanita has gifted us with a self-fulfilling prophecy. We will be the generation that gets it right as long as we believe we are. After all, “God is good all the time, and all the time God is good." Each time El spoke "God is good all the time, and all the time God is good," the entire class recited the words as one, unifying voice.
 
The class sang "Joseph, Father" before Sr. Karen Kirby, CSJ bestowed the Final Blessing upon the class. As is the tradition at the Academy, the evening closed with the graduates singing “The Lord Bless You and Keep You” to each other.
